Starting therapy can feel like a vulnerable step — whether you’re reaching out for yourself, your child, or your family. My goal is to create a space where therapy feels welcoming, supportive, and genuinely helpful from the start.
I work with children, teens, adults, couples, and families navigating anxiety, emotional overwhelm, relationship challenges, parenting stress, life transitions, and grief.
I integrate evidence-based approaches including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), helping clients understand patterns between thoughts, emotions, and behaviors while building skills for emotional regulation, communication, and resilience.
I provide in-person therapy in El Dorado Hills and telehealth services throughout California, allowing flexibility to meet clients where they feel most comfortable.
My hope is that therapy becomes a place where you can feel understood, capable, and supported in taking meaningful steps forward — even when life feels uncertain.
